Can dogs eat Mursik?

No. Mursik is dangerous for dogs due to its high levels of ethanol and acetaldehyde, both of which are toxic to canines. Ingesting this fermented milk can lead to alcohol poisoning, which may result in severe health complications or even be fatal. It's best to keep mursik far away from your dog’s bowl.

  • The fermentation process causes the live cultures in mursik to produce high levels of ethanol and acetaldehyde. Both compounds are dangerous to dogs as they can induce poisoning.
